Understanding CI/CD Pipelines

Continuous Integration (CI) and Continuous Deployment (CD) pipelines form the backbone of DevOps practices. These processes ensure that code changes are automatically tested and deployed, greatly enhancing development speed and reliability.

Key skills in this area include familiarity with tools such as Jenkins, GitLab CI, and GitHub Actions. Mastery of these tools enables teams to implement automated tests and deployment triggers, ensuring the software is always in a deployable state.

Additionally, understanding the concept of version control within CI/CD frameworks is essential. This includes branching strategies, merge requests, and collaboration—all vital for maintaining code quality and project timelines.

Container Orchestration Mastery

As applications increasingly move to containerized environments, expertise in container orchestration platforms such as Kubernetes and Docker Swarm is becoming vital. These tools automatically manage workloads, scaling, and service discovery.

A DevOps professional should know how to configure Kubernetes clusters, manage deployments, and handle scaling operations based on user demand. This skill set allows for efficient application management, reducing downtime and enhancing user experience.

Implementing service meshes alongside container orchestration can also enhance security and observability in microservices architectures, which is another valuable aspect of modern cloud infrastructure skills.

Building Incident Response Workflows

Incident response workflows are critical for maintaining service reliability and security in cloud environments. Understanding how to implement effective monitoring, alerting, and incident management processes is essential for any DevOps team.

Skills in using tools like PagerDuty, Datadog, and Splunk can significantly improve your ability to detect, respond to, and remediate incidents swiftly. Knowledge of how to integrate these tools with your overall infrastructure can streamline communication and minimize downtime during outages.

Moreover, developing a culture of post-mortem analysis within teams can help in learning from past incidents, fostering continuous improvement in operational practices.

Utilizing Automated Deployment Tools

Automated deployment tools are key to implementing seamless rollouts and rollbacks in production environments. Proficiency in tools such as Terraform, Ansible, and AWS CloudFormation allows teams to automate infrastructure provisioning and management effectively.

It is crucial to develop Terraform module scaffolds that ensure best practices in infrastructure as code (IaC). This modular approach not only enhances reusability but also simplifies maintenance across environments.

Understanding security scanning tools is also paramount. Integrating security into your deployment pipelines can catch vulnerabilities early, promoting a DevSecOps mindset across the team.

Frequently Asked Questions

1. What are the most important DevOps skills to have?

The most important DevOps skills include proficiency in CI/CD pipelines, container orchestration, automated deployment tools, and incident response management. Mastery of these areas will greatly enhance your capabilities in cloud infrastructure.

2. How do CI/CD pipelines improve development processes?

CI/CD pipelines automate the testing and deployment processes, allowing for faster releases and more reliable code integration. This automation helps teams quickly deliver updates while maintaining high standards of quality.

3. What tools are commonly used in incident response workflows?

Common tools used in incident response workflows include PagerDuty for incident management, Datadog for monitoring, and Splunk for logging and analysis. These tools help teams detect and resolve incidents proactively.
